Android Studio如何進(jìn)行應(yīng)用簽名

小樊
81
2024-10-09 01:02:35

在Android Studio中進(jìn)行應(yīng)用簽名是發(fā)布應(yīng)用前的重要步驟,它確保了應(yīng)用的安全性和完整性。以下是Android Studio應(yīng)用簽名的步驟:

應(yīng)用簽名步驟

  1. 生成簽名文件
  • 在Android Studio中,選擇Build > Generate Signed Bundle / APK。
  • 如果是第一次簽名,點(diǎn)擊Create new創(chuàng)建新的簽名文件。
  • 填寫(xiě)相關(guān)信息,如密鑰庫(kù)文件路徑、密碼、別名等。
  1. 選擇簽名版本
  • 在生成簽名APK對(duì)話框中,選擇APK選項(xiàng)。
  • 勾選V1和V2簽名方案,點(diǎn)擊Finish。

簽名配置方法

  • 通過(guò)項(xiàng)目配置界面配置簽名

    • 進(jìn)入項(xiàng)目配置界面,選擇app > Signing > Add添加簽名相關(guān)信息。
    • 創(chuàng)建簽名配置,選擇Build Types > Signing Config

簽名工具

  • 使用Android Studio內(nèi)置的簽名工具:Android Studio提供了內(nèi)置的簽名工具,可以直接在IDE中進(jìn)行簽名操作。
  • 使用keytool工具:keytool是Java開(kāi)發(fā)工具包(JDK)提供的一個(gè)命令行工具,用于生成和管理Java密鑰庫(kù)和證書(shū)。

常見(jiàn)問(wèn)題及解決方法

  • 簽名時(shí)V1和V2無(wú)法被選擇:確保Android Studio和Gradle插件是最新版本,因?yàn)榕f版本可能存在兼容性問(wèn)題。

通過(guò)以上步驟,您可以輕松地在Android Studio中進(jìn)行應(yīng)用簽名,確保您的應(yīng)用能夠安全地發(fā)布到用戶手中。

0